summaryrefslogtreecommitdiff
path: root/plugins
diff options
context:
space:
mode:
authorwl2776 <wl2776@users.noreply.github.com>2021-08-27 19:07:19 +0300
committerGitHub <noreply@github.com>2021-08-27 18:07:19 +0200
commit0c590aba74f28e94f03eb918c07a90cf1a51f525 (patch)
tree856be6b69ba88f43362d825c6e68d0c16238fd1f /plugins
parent3f0672ff946a508329e382261e6eb8f837106e38 (diff)
downloadzsh-0c590aba74f28e94f03eb918c07a90cf1a51f525.tar.gz
zsh-0c590aba74f28e94f03eb918c07a90cf1a51f525.tar.bz2
zsh-0c590aba74f28e94f03eb918c07a90cf1a51f525.zip
fix(git): fix `gbda` alias when there are no merged branches (#10005)
Diffstat (limited to 'plugins')
-rw-r--r--plugins/git/README.md2
-rw-r--r--plugins/git/git.plugin.zsh2
2 files changed, 2 insertions, 2 deletions
diff --git a/plugins/git/README.md b/plugins/git/README.md
index 522257d2d..48cf87204 100644
--- a/plugins/git/README.md
+++ b/plugins/git/README.md
@@ -23,7 +23,7 @@ plugins=(... git)
| gb | git branch |
| gba | git branch -a |
| gbd | git branch -d |
-| gbda | git branch --no-color --merged \| command grep -vE "^(\+\|\*\|\s*($(git_main_branch)\|$(git_develop_branch))\s*$)" \| command xargs -n 1 git branch -d |
+| gbda | git branch --no-color --merged \| grep -vE "^([+*]\|\s*($(git_main_branch)\|$(git_develop_branch))\s*$)" \| xargs git branch -d 2>/dev/null |
| gbD | git branch -D |
| gbl | git blame -b -w |
| gbnm | git branch --no-merged |
diff --git a/plugins/git/git.plugin.zsh b/plugins/git/git.plugin.zsh
index 3cd558692..f0d9aaedc 100644
--- a/plugins/git/git.plugin.zsh
+++ b/plugins/git/git.plugin.zsh
@@ -73,7 +73,7 @@ alias gapt='git apply --3way'
alias gb='git branch'
alias gba='git branch -a'
alias gbd='git branch -d'
-alias gbda='git branch --no-color --merged | command grep -vE "^(\+|\*|\s*($(git_main_branch)|$(git_develop_branch))\s*$)" | command xargs -n 1 git branch -d'
+alias gbda='git branch --no-color --merged | command grep -vE "^([+*]|\s*($(git_main_branch)|$(git_develop_branch))\s*$)" | command xargs git branch -d 2>/dev/null'
alias gbD='git branch -D'
alias gbl='git blame -b -w'
alias gbnm='git branch --no-merged'